Industry Analysis
NVIDIA's adjustment of HBM capacity in its Rubin Ultra AI accelerator highlights structural supply chain pressures amid surging demand for advanced chips. By reducing HBM per unit, the company alleviates bottlenecks while increasing shipments, driving HBM ASP to rise 79%, surpassing earlier forecasts. This move reflects intensified competition among upstream suppliers like Samsung, SK Hynix, and Micron over HBM4 and HBM4E capacity. Technologically, modular and customizable HBM configurations are becoming industry norms, signaling a shift toward flexible chip design. Geopolitically, such adjustments mirror strategic responses to export controls and supply chain fragmentation amid U.S.-China tech rivalry. Competitors are likely to adopt similar tactics, escalating market competition for high-end memory. Over the next 12–24 months, sustained HBM price increases and supply chain resilience will define competitive advantage in the AI chip sector.
